The phrase 'Everybody swear they solid. Ice is too, until you put a lil heat on it' metaphorically captures the essence of resilience and vulnerability. This article reflects on how individuals often present themselves as strong and unyielding, much like ice. However, under pressure or adversity—akin to heat—true character is revealed. Strength isn't merely maintaining appearances; it encompasses the ability to adapt, face fears, and even melt down at times, only to emerge renewed. In the realm of mental health, this idea becomes crucial, as many individuals struggle to maintain an image of unwavering strength while facing internal battles. Acknowledging vulnerability and se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Understanding the balance between showcasing strength and allowing oneself to be vulnerable can lead to personal growth and stronger connections with others.
